Surely you know who Dodo was. She was a first Doctor companion. They were half way through filming The War Machines when the BBC sent her a telegram saying her services were no longer required and not to come back to work so after episode 2 she just dissapeared and was never in it again. They replaced her with Ben and Polly from the same story and just said that she had gone to stay with her aunt. No goodbyes or anything. She was just there one minute and then gone the next. Apparantly they didn't feel she was hip enough or something
